Output d85cb6e406bb8f7798653060d657d6325a9e5a03d98f381bcc667b62f3e6e9a6:0

value
102143333
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 368e3eea70917152b3b74acd1557136b31fc95e6 OP_EQUALVERIFY OP_CHECKSIG
address
15yTtmY33uFdndj6AB4Pbpc3Z4KtzqhXFf
transaction
d85cb6e406bb8f7798653060d657d6325a9e5a03d98f381bcc667b62f3e6e9a6
spent
true